在Oracle数据库中深入探索AS关键字(oracle中as关键字)

在Oracle数据库中深入探索AS关键字

在Oracle数据库中,AS是一个非常有用的关键字,它可以用来为查询中的列或表达式设置别名,使查询结果更具可读性。此外,AS还可以用于执行数据库对象重命名操作,例如重命名表、列、函数等。在本文中,我们将深入探索AS关键字在Oracle数据库中的用法。

1. 使用AS关键字为列或表达式设置别名

在查询中,AS关键字可以用于为列或表达式设置别名,语法如下:

SELECT column AS alias

FROM table;

其中,column为查询中要设置别名的列或表达式,alias为别名。

例如,我们有一个employees表,其中包含first_name和last_name两个列,我们可以使用AS关键字为这两列设置别名如下:

SELECT first_name AS fname, last_name AS lname

FROM employees;

这将返回一个包含fname和lname列的结果集,而不是原始的first_name和last_name列。

2. 使用AS关键字重命名数据库对象

除了用于查询中的别名设置,AS关键字还可以用于为数据库中的对象重命名,例如表、列、函数等。语法如下:

ALTER OBJECT object_name RENAME TO new_name;

其中,object_name为要重命名的对象名称,new_name为新的名称。

例如,我们有一个名为employees的表,我们可以使用AS关键字将其重命名为staff如下:

ALTER TABLE employees RENAME TO staff;

此时,employees表将被重命名为staff表。同样,AS关键字也可以用于重命名列、函数等数据库对象。

总结

在本文中,我们深入探索了在Oracle数据库中使用AS关键字的用法。AS关键字可以用于为查询中的列或表达式设置别名,让查询结果更具可读性;同时,它还可以用于重命名数据库中的对象,例如表、列、函数等。熟练掌握AS关键字的使用方法将有助于提高查询效率和代码可读性。


数据运维技术 » 在Oracle数据库中深入探索AS关键字(oracle中as关键字)